Construction Attorney Strategy Leads to E-2 Visa Approval for Construction Manager in New York



Strategic guidance from a Construction Attorney played a decisive role in securing E-2 visa approval for a Construction Manager assigned to a New York job site.


This case illustrates how a Construction Attorney can clearly demonstrate the operational necessity of transferring key personnel in specialized equipment and construction environments.


By structuring the petition around business continuityproject oversight, and managerial authority, the Construction Attorney ensured that the applicant’s role met E-2 eligibility standards.


As a result of this carefully prepared approach, the E-2 visa was approved without delay or additional evidence requests.

1. Construction Attorney New York– Case Background and Project Context


This case involved a company specializing in high-precision and special-purpose construction equipment that required assistance from a Construction Attorney for U.S. expansion.


To support ongoing projects in New York, the company determined that transferring a senior Construction Manager was essential to maintaining operational control and quality standards.



Specialized Construction and Equipment Management Experience


The applicant had extensive experience overseeing construction projects involving specialized equipmentscheduling, and on-site coordination under the guidance of a Construction Attorney.


Rather than engaging in hands-on labor, the applicant managed site operationssubcontractor coordination, and workflow sequencing.


This distinction was emphasized by the Construction Attorney to establish the applicant as a managerial professional.


Such positioning is critical in New York E-2 cases involving construction and infrastructure projects.



2. Construction Attorney New York– Aligning the Role with E-2 Visa Standards


A key objective for the Construction Attorney was to ensure the U.S. position satisfied E-2 requirements for supervisory and managerial responsibility.


New York immigration officers closely review whether a Construction Manager will perform manual labor, making Construction Attorney oversightessential.



Structuring the Construction Manager Role


With direction from a Construction Attorney, the applicant’s U.S. role was structured around project oversightprogress monitoring, and coordination with engineering and site teams.


The job description clarified that the applicant would supervise construction phases rather than perform physical installation work.


This structure, supported by the Construction Attorney, demonstrated compliance with E-2 role expectations.


Clear role definition reduced the risk of misinterpretation during adjudication.



3. Construction Attorney New York– Petition Documentation and Legal Strategy

The E-2 petition was prepared under close supervision of a Construction Attorney to ensure consistency across all documents.


Each submission reinforced the necessity of transferring this Construction Manager to oversee U.S. operations in New York.



Demonstrating Business Necessity Through Documentation


The Construction Attorney focused on showing that the applicant’s experience was embedded in the company’s project execution model.


Organizational chartsproject timelines, and operational descriptions highlighted the applicant’s leadership role.


These materials illustrated why local hiring alone could not replace the applicant’s expertise.


Such documentation, guided by a Construction Attorney, strengthened the credibility of the petition.



4. Construction Attorney New York– Interview Preparation and Approval Outcome


Interview preparation was the final stage where the Construction Attorney played a critical role.


E-2 interviews in New York often center on business structure and job necessity, requiring consistent explanations.



Interview Consistency and Final Approval


Prior to the interview, the Construction Attorney conducted detailed preparation sessions focused on anticipated questions.


The applicant clearly explained the construction management rolereporting structure, and need for U.S. oversight.


Because the responses aligned with the petition narrative prepared by the Construction Attorney, the interview proceeded smoothly.


The E-2 visa was approved without any follow-up requests.
